William Edward Ulbricht

William E. Ulbricht

Nov. 13, 1917 - Feb. 3, 1998

William E. Ulbricht, 80, of Crown Hill Drive, South Bend, Ind., died at 1 p.m. on Tuesday, Feb. 3, in the Ironwood Health and Rehabilitation Center, South Bend. He was born on Nov. 13, 1917, in South Bend, and was a lifelong resident.

He married Marian Hoffer, who preceded him in death on Nov. 1, 1965. On Sept. 12, 1974, he married Dariel High, who preceded him in death on May 31, 1992.

Mr. Ulbricht is survived by a daughter, Joann Stanley of Eskdale, W.Va.; a son, Michael Ulbricht of South Bend; two granddaughters, Sabrina and Amber Stanley of Eskdale; a sister, Avis Davis of South Bend; and a brother, Ernest Ulbricht of North Liberty, Ind.; and his friend and companion, Inez Van Ooteghem of Mishawaka, Ind.

Mr. Ulbricht was a retired electronic technician and had worked for WTRC, and had last worked in the maintenance department at the University of Notre Dame. He was a member of Christ the King Lutheran Church, South Bend; South Bend Lions Club; Elkhart Moose Lodge; and he was a veteran of World War II, serving in the Army Air Force; and was a member of Veterans of Foreign Wars Post 360.

Services will be at 11 a.m. on Friday in Christ the King Lutheran Church, South Bend, where friends may call two hours prior to the services. Cremation will take place with burial in St. Joseph Valley Memorial Park, Granger, Ind.
